About

Dr Roger Tian graduated from the National University of Singapore in 1996 and subsequently trained to obtain his postgraduate qualifications in surgery before commencing his practice in sports medicine. His clinical interests include the management and prevention of sports injuries, strength and conditioning, as well as sports nutrition. Dr Tian is also active in education and research, having publications in several international peer-reviewed journals.

On top of his existing professional appointments, Dr Tian has also contributed to various external boards and committees and he has served as a sports physician at several events.
